In the above video VectorBloom's founder, Elizabeth Boylan speaks about the technology innovation plans we have using our video game Big Top Ballet as a platform. The video itself has been uploaded as part of an application entry for this year's BDC Young Entrepreneur Award. Qualified applicants must prepare a video pitching their innovation project to the BDC where eleven finalists will be selected. Canadians will then be invited to vote nationally on the best video candidate where the winner will be awarded $100,000.00 to help make their project a reality.

After reviewing our google analytics for searches- we'll be adding some extra in-game hints for how to play Big Top Ballet. For now, here's our blog post with added screen shots that we have also added to the App Store .
Game 1 has been inspired by paper dolls with their outfits that attach by folding the white tabs. The object of the game is to dress as many 'paper' ballerinas as you can by dragging floating costume pieces and touching the white tab. Just 2 weeks ago we released version 1.0 of Big Top Ballet to iOS. We had a successful campaign on Appbackr for the iOS version of the game and we've decided to post a second campaign to help us raise funds to promote the release of the Android version of Big Top Ballet. Since we haven't yet released to the Android Market ( Now Google's Play) any backr can earn up to 54% profit with a minimum backing of $42.00.
